The West is recycling rare earths to escape China’s grip — but it’s not enough
cnbc.com/2025/05/28/china-controlled-rare-earths-account-for-3-pounds-of-an-electric-car-ev.html
BEIJING — As China tightens its grip on the global supply of key minerals, the West is working to reduce its dependence on Chinese rare earth.
This includes finding alternative sources of rare earth minerals, developing technologies to reduce reliance, and recovering existing stockpiles…
